考试网 >> IT认证 >> 水平 >> 其它 >> 2005年上半年软件评测师下午试题

2005年上半年软件评测师下午试题

发布时间:2006-06-28 02:35     点击:
分页:[1] 2 3  下一页

试题一(15 分)

  阅读以下说明,回答问题1 至问题4,将解答填入答题纸的对应栏内。

【说明】

  在软件开发与运行阶段一般需要完成单元测试、集成测试、确认测试、系统测试和验收测试,这些对软件质量保证起着非常关键的作用。

【问题1】(5 分)

  请简述单元测试的主要内容。

【问题2】(5 分)

  集成测试也叫组装测试或者联合测试,请简述集成测试的主要内容。

【问题3】(2 分)

  请简述集成测试与系统测试的关系

【问题4】(3 分)

  公司A 承担了业务B 的办公自动化系统的建设工作。2004 年10 月初,项目正处于开发阶段,预计2005 年5 月能够完成全部开发工作,但是合同规定2004 年10 月底进行系统验收。因此2004 年10 月初,公司A 依据合同规定向业主B 和监理方提出在2004 年10 月底进行验收测试的请求,并提出了详细的测试计划和测试方案。在该方案中指出测试小组由公司A 的测试工程师、外聘测试专家、外聘行业专家以及监理方的代表组成公司A 的做法是否正确?请给出理由。

试题二(15 分)

  阅读下列说明,回答问题1 至问题3,将解答填入大体纸的对应栏内。

【说明】

  使用基本路径法设计出的测试用例能够保证程序的每一条可执行语句在测试过程中至少执行一次。以下代码由C 语言书写,请按要求回答问题。

  Int IsLeap(int year)

  {

   if (year % 4 == 0)

   {

    if (year % 100 == 0)

    {

     if ( year % 400 == 0)

      leap = 1;

     else

     leap = 0;

    }

    else

    leap = 1;

   }

   else

   leap = 0;

   return leap;

  }

【问题1】(3 分)

  请画出以上代码的控制流图

【问题2】(4 分)

  请计算上述控制流图的圈复杂度V(G)(独立线性路径数)

【问题3】(8 分)

  假设输入的取值范围是1000 < year < 2001,请使用基本路径测试法为变量year 设计测试用例,使其满足基本路径覆盖的要求。
分页:[1] 2 3  下一页
版权申明:未经书面授权请勿转载本站信息!!作品版权归所属媒体与作者所有!!
发表评论: 匿名发表 用户名: 查看评论
您将承担一切因您的行为、言论而直接或间接导致的民事或刑事法律责任
留言板管理人员有权保留或删除其管辖留言中的任意内容
本站提醒:不要进行人身攻击。谢谢配合。
在本站搜索相关信息
2003-2005 Ksw123.com All Rights Reserved. - TOP
Copyright © 2006 Ksw123.com. All rights reserved.中国考题网 版权所有